当没有接口文档时,如何使用Jmeter录制和创建脚本

  • 1、抓包
  • 2、badboy
  • 3、Jmeter自带的http代理服务器
    • 1)新建线程组
  • 2)新建代理服务器:测试计划-》非配置元件-》代理服务器
    • 端口:8888
    • 目标控制器:设置为你录制的目标线程组。
    • Type:默认httpclient
  • 3)完成设置后,点击"启动",运行代理服务器

《点OK》

《打开录制窗口》

  • 4)客户端设置:让客户端的请求通过代理服务器发送。
    • 在控制面板-》Internet选项->连接-》局域网配置
  • 5)完成客户端设置后,访问浏览器就可将抓包连接自动写入线程组中。如下图:
  • 6)代理服务器中设置筛选排除过滤器
  • 7)几乎所有WEB项目均需加cookie管理器,存储token等内容
  • 8)token是动态值,需提取动态的token值,并保存到全局变量中

《请求提交token参数的值改为变量名》

<执行成功>

  • 9)增加调试取样器,方便查看提取的变量等内容
相关推荐
卓码软件测评4 小时前
第三方应用测试:【移动应用后端API自动化测试:Postman与Newman的集成】
功能测试·测试工具·测试用例·可用性测试
BatyTao5 小时前
Fiddler抓包+Jmeter实战之--jxycrm客户关系管理软件
jmeter·fiddler
青草地溪水旁14 小时前
tcpdump调试
网络·测试工具·tcpdump
卓码软件测评2 天前
第三方软件验收测试:【AutoIt与Selenium结合测试文件上传/下载等Windows对话框】
windows·功能测试·selenium·测试工具·性能优化·可用性测试
最好的我们!2 天前
解决selenium的EdgeOptions addArguments is not supported问题
selenium·测试工具
万粉变现经纪人3 天前
如何解决 pip install 安装报错 ImportError: cannot import name ‘xxx’ from ‘yyy’ 问题
python·selenium·测试工具·flask·scikit-learn·fastapi·pip
卓码软件测评3 天前
第三方软件登记测试机构:【软件登记测试机构HTML5测试技术】
前端·功能测试·测试工具·html·测试用例·html5
可可南木3 天前
ICT 数字测试原理 3 --SAFETYGUARD 文件
开发语言·测试工具·pcb工艺
卓码软件测评3 天前
第三方软件测试公司:【Gatling基于Scala的开源高性能负载测试工具】
测试工具·开源·scala·压力测试·可用性测试·第三方软件测试
paid槮4 天前
selenium完整版一览
selenium·测试工具